  What you’ll do with “Our Training and Your Experience”

  Convergint's greatest strength is our people! Every colleague is encouraged to participate in our Recruit Awesome People program, helping us grow Convergint by promoting our colleague-first culture and referring top talent to the Talent Acquisition Team and hiring managers.

  Acts as “our customer’s best service provider” at all times thereby ensuring Convergint is the customer’s first choice for service.

  Respond to routine and some non-routine customer service calls, scheduled maintenance calls and service calls on a timely basis; diagnose, troubleshoot, repair, replace defective parts and debug systems for routine problems; install projects as necessary.

  Use solid troubleshooting skills to isolate and fix problems in malfunctioning equipment or software.

  Identifies and resolves problems for many types of service calls; analyzes repair requirements and provides customer with appropriate solutions; completes necessary repairs and replacements as needed; exercises judgment in selecting methods, techniques, and evaluation criterion for obtaining results.

  Completes accurate and detailed service reports for customer and Convergint in a timely manner to allow for accurate invoicing and job cost tracking.

  May provide custom systems integrations, detailed systems upgrade planning and execution, systems audits and consultation, and/or database management and manipulation. May install, configure, and support a variety of network systems and equipment for assigned projects.

  Executes all service calls in accordance with Federal, State and local regulations as well as company health and safety policies and procedures. Uses solid troubleshooting skills to isolate and fix problems in malfunctioning equipment or software.

  Communicates with and work with the other team members consistently to improve overall operations of the Convergint Technology Center, and company.

  Responsible for primarily performing preventative maintenance for installed systems that are typically less complex.

  Work closely with other specialists to cross-train on servicing existing customers by responding to service calls, carrying out Customer Support Programs and small projects business.

  Scope of work includes technical assistance, systems checkout of new and existing installations, troubleshooting and maintenance and repair routines associated with installed Security and the installation of small or less complex projects.

  Performs other duties and responsibilities as requested or required.

  What You’ll Need

  Exceptional customer focus and ability to work under pressure; ability to maintain awareness of, and seek to meet the needs and wants of the customer without being prompted.

  Solid technical skills and/or experience related to fire alarm systems, and/or electronic security systems.

  Solid programming skills and proven ability to troubleshoot problems and look for solutions.

  Must be a self-starter and work well with direct supervision.

  Solid mechanical and electrical aptitude (e.g. works with a variety of hand and power tools such as drill, screwdriver, wire stripper, hacksaw, crimper).

  A valid driver’s license with a clean driving record.

  Ability to travel locally to jobsites on a regular basis. Minimal overnight travel may be required.

  Requirements:

  Education: High School/GED or equivalent experience

  Minimum Experience: 5-10 years servicing, integrating, and programming access control systems

  Preferred Experience: (but not required):

  Relevant field service

  CCTV experience: Milestone / Genetec

  Access Control experience: AMAG / Lenel / Genetec / Software House - CCURE / S2

  Intrusion experience: DMP / Bosch
